BIS Highlights Risks of Excessive AI Investments Amid Financial Concerns

The Bank for International Settlements (BIS) has raised alarms about the potential systemic risks associated with the surge in artificial intelligence investments. Analysts suggest that the financing of these ventures has heavily depended on substantial debt.

Concerns are particularly focused on highly leveraged nonbank financial structures, which are seen as susceptible to rapid unwinding. This situation could lead to broader financial instability if not managed carefully.

As AI continues to attract significant capital, the BIS's warnings serve as a critical reminder of the need for caution in investment strategies to mitigate potential global financial consequences.
